The dialogue Hipparchus (I do not deal with the question of its authorship) is a lively and rich dialogue. Its most striking feature is its presentation of the Platonic evaluative reductionism, very similar to the versions known from Plato's Lysis and Charmides: for the purpose of practical evaluation, it is best to restrict oneself to the one-dimensional scale between good and bad (or useful and harmful). I discuss the position of this proposal in the history of ethics and philosophy of action, and I show why all the passages where Plato or his followers use this principle the results are so implausible and unsatisfactory. It is because Plato does not introduce any criterion that would help one to determine a position of an action in question on that scale.
